Description

Wiggle your toes on the Trinity Lake’s pristine sandy beaches and take in the water-based painted canvass that Mother Nature, herself, has created; Minersville Campground has just such a painting on display. Hugging the lake’s tranquil beach, Minersville Campground is geared toward toward the minimalist camper. If you’re fortunate enough to reserve and later pitch-up a tent in the popular campground, you’ll be delighted at the Picasso-like work in front of you―just don’t go about taking any “souvenirs” with you.
